JOB SUMMARY
Special Events staff for the Pumpkin Days and Hay Maze Event beginning September through the end of October. Must have excellent customer service and communications skills. We are looking for motivated, reliable, people-friendly staff in the following areas: setup of hay maze, ticket takers, cashiers, cow train drivers, and tour guides.
Schedules available include: days, nights, and weekends.
This is an outdoor position and applicant must be prepared to work in all weather conditions: rain, sun, wind, or snow. Ensures safety of farm and program and provides excellent customer service.
M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S
Must be at least 16 years of age at the time of hire.
Other minimum qualifications may be required depending on the exact position under this title.
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S
TEMPORARY POSITIONS:
An “At Will”, FLSA non-exempt employee who is not eligible for County benefits and who must work an average of 29 hours or less per week or an average of 129 hours or less per month.
